# Quillbus Broker Environments

Heads up for on-call: we're mid-upgrade on the Quillbus message broker. Staging is already on the 5.x line; prod flips next Tuesday. During the window, consumers will reconnect automatically, but anything pinned to the old wire protocol will stall — restart those pods rather than waiting. Dead-letter queues drain slower on 5.x, so don't panic at the graphs. The staging broker runs with these values.

settings of yagag-kahop:
FENWYN_PIN=6385
FENWYN_METRICS_HOST=metrics.fenwyn.nelvrolabs.corp
FENWYN_LOG_LEVEL=error
FENWYN_TENANT=casok

Ticket #— Floor 9 Opening Prep, Brindlemoor House

Hi facilities folks, Floor 9 opens to staff next Monday and we need a few things squared away before then. Lift access is live, but the two side doors by the kitchenette are still on the old lock config — please reprogram them before Friday. Also, signage for the quiet rooms hasn't arrived, so pop up the temporary printed ones for now. Until the badge readers sync, the interim door code for Floor 9 is below.

door code, bajop-bajog: bdg-DSWAC-43621

## Break-Glass Access: Autocomplete Index (Quillhaven Search)

New team members: the Quillhaven autocomplete index occasionally degrades and queries exceed 4 seconds. Normal remediation goes through the Lattice console, but if the console itself is unreachable, break-glass access to the index node is permitted. Document your reason in the shift log first. The emergency account unlocks with the passphrase recorded below.

strongbox words: oliath-framir

### Runbook: Report export timezone mismatches (Glimmerfield)

If a customer reports that exported totals differ from the dashboard, check whether their report schedule predates the March cutover — older schedules still render in server-local time rather than the account timezone. Re-saving the schedule fixes it. Before escalating, confirm the export worker is running with the expected timezone settings shown below.

config for kadup-kajog:
[raldor]
host = raldor.tolvaqworks.internal
user = raldor_svc
database = raldor_prod